Population By Race and Ethnicity in Sherman, NE in 2013

Updated on June 16,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2013, the 3,062 population of Sherman County, Nebraska comprised of 58 people who identified as Hispanic (1.89%), and 3,004 people who identified as Non-Hispanic (98.11%).

Race: The White Alone population was the largest racial group in Sherman County, Nebraska with a population of 3,028 (98.89%); Two Or More Races population was the second largest racial group with a population of 13 (0.43%); and Asian Alone was the third largest racial group with a population of 10 (0.33%).

Ethnicity: The White Alone - Non Hispanic population was the largest ethnic group in Sherman County, Nebraska in 2013, with a population of 2,970 (97%); the second largest ethnic group was White Alone - Hispanic with a population of 58 (1.89%); and the third largest ethnic group was Two Or More Races - Non Hispanic with a population of 13 (0.43%).
